Some of the women whom I send off to practice masturbation tell me that, no matter what they do, they can’t seem to get sufficient stimulation. They report feeling as if they’re close to having an orgasm, but they can’t get past that point to actually have one.

Turning men on doesn’t take much; if you’re not careful, you can do it accidentally. A man can have an erection in what seems like milliseconds. Be sure you are communicating when you want to be intimate, and if you aren’t in the mood, be sure to communicate why.
